Interior Wall Framing in Kansas City, KS
Interior wall framing services involve constructing the structural framework that supports interior walls within a property. These services are essential for creating new rooms, dividing existing spaces, or remodeling areas such as basements, garages, or interior offices. Property owners typically request this service when planning a home renovation, adding a new bedroom, or reconfiguring the layout of a house or commercial space. Understanding the scope of interior wall framing, including the materials used and the compatibility with existing structures, helps homeowners ensure the project meets safety and design expectations.
Before requesting interior wall framing services, property owners should consider factors such as the purpose of the new walls, the type of materials preferred, and any necessary modifications to electrical or plumbing systems. It’s also useful to clarify whether the framing will be load-bearing or non-load-bearing, as this influences the complexity of the work. Proper planning ensures the framing aligns with building codes and structural requirements, contributing to a safe and functional interior space.

Interior Wall Framing Questions
What is interior wall framing? Interior wall framing involves constructing the framework that supports interior walls, creating rooms and defining spaces within a building.
What types of projects require wall framing? Wall framing is needed for new construction, room additions, basement finishing, or remodeling existing interior spaces.
What materials are used for interior wall framing? Typically, wood or metal studs are used to build the framework for interior walls.
How does wall framing impact room layout? Proper framing ensures accurate room dimensions, support for drywall, and a stable structure for doors and windows.
